
The short answer
Diet soda does not have proven brain-damaging effects in ordinary amounts. Current research raises questions about frequent intake, sweeteners, caffeine, and long-term health patterns.
Most alarming headlines rely on observational studies. These studies can find links, but they cannot prove diet soda caused memory loss, stroke, or dementia.

How the advice changed
Early worries focused on ingredients
Public concern began with artificial sweeteners, not with the brain itself. Saccharin faced cancer concerns during the twentieth century, while regulators reviewed animal studies and human exposure.
Those fears shaped a simple message: natural sugar seemed safer than synthetic sweeteners. Later reviews found the human risk from approved sweeteners remained low at normal intake levels.
Diet soda gained a health advantage
During the 1980s and 1990s, diet soda became a practical replacement for sugary drinks. It offered familiar taste without sugar or calories.
That advice made sense for people who replaced regular soda with diet soda. It was never a complete health assessment. A zero-calorie drink can still support a habit of frequent sweet drinks.
Brain studies changed the tone
Research during the 2010s linked frequent diet drink intake with stroke and dementia in some groups. News coverage often treated those findings as proof of direct brain harm.
Scientists later stressed the study limits. People with diabetes, obesity, high blood pressure, or existing vascular risk may choose diet drinks more often. Those conditions can also affect brain health.
More recent work examines gut microbes, appetite signals, blood vessels, sleep, and dietary patterns. The evidence remains mixed. No single mechanism explains every association.
Advice that was wrong
Diet soda is automatically healthier
This statement is too broad. Diet soda usually contains fewer calories than sugar-sweetened soda, but that fact does not make it a nutritious drink.
The better comparison depends on the replacement. Diet soda may reduce sugar intake when it replaces regular soda. Water, unsweetened tea, or plain sparkling water usually adds fewer dietary concerns.
Diet soda causes brain damage
Current evidence does not support this claim. Observational links cannot separate the drink from health conditions, diet quality, smoking, sleep, income, or medical treatment.
Some studies still deserve attention. A weak causal claim is not the same as no research signal. It means the signal needs better testing.
One can creates a dangerous exposure
Approved sweeteners have intake limits based on safety reviews. Those limits include substantial safety margins and apply to average daily exposure.
Risk rises with total intake, not with a single occasional can. The exact sweetener also matters, so check the label for the product you drink.
Advice that was always situational
Use diet soda during weight loss
This can work for some people. A diet drink may satisfy a soda habit without adding sugar or calories.
Other people find sweet taste keeps cravings active. Some also compensate with snacks later. Track your own hunger and intake for several weeks.
Drink it for caffeine
Caffeine can improve alertness, but timing matters. Late-day caffeine may shorten sleep or reduce sleep quality.

Avoid it during pregnancy
Pregnancy advice focuses on total caffeine, not only diet soda. Health professionals often recommend a daily caffeine limit, commonly 200 milligrams during pregnancy.
Count coffee, tea, energy drinks, chocolate, and medicines too. Sweetener guidance can vary with the product and local health advice.
Stop if it causes symptoms
Some people report headaches, reflux, bloating, or an aftertaste after diet soda. Caffeine, carbonation, acidity, and individual sweeteners can all play a role.

What science says about the brain
Memory and dementia
Several cohort studies reported associations between diet drinks and later cognitive decline. These findings often appeared after researchers followed adults for years.
Such studies cannot establish timing with certainty. Early disease may change food choices before diagnosis. Other health factors may explain part of the association.
Randomized trials rarely last long enough to test dementia. They usually measure appetite, glucose, weight, or short-term cognitive effects instead.
Stroke and blood vessels
Some research connects frequent artificially sweetened drink intake with vascular events. High blood pressure, diabetes, smoking, and inactivity can distort those results.
Blood vessel health remains central to brain health. The stronger, unchanged advice is to control blood pressure, avoid smoking, exercise regularly, and manage diabetes.
Attention and alertness
Caffeine blocks adenosine, a brain signal linked with sleepiness. This effect can improve alertness for a few hours.
Regular caffeine use can produce tolerance. Sudden withdrawal may cause headache, fatigue, or poor concentration. A gradual reduction often feels easier.
Appetite and reward
Sweet taste can activate reward pathways even without sugar. Scientists study whether this affects appetite, cravings, or later food choices.
Human results vary. Some trials find little effect on hunger. Others find differences between individuals, especially with frequent use.
Gut-brain signals
Sweeteners may interact with gut microbes and intestinal taste receptors. Results differ across sweeteners, doses, and people.
Animal findings do not translate neatly to human drinking habits. Researchers still lack a reliable test showing ordinary diet soda directly harms the human brain through the gut.
What has not changed
Water remains the simplest everyday drink. Unsweetened tea and plain sparkling water also avoid sweeteners and added sugar.
Regular soda still supplies substantial sugar. Replacing it with a no-calorie diet drink can lower sugar exposure, especially when the person does not replace those calories with snacks.
Sleep, blood pressure, movement, smoking, and diabetes control matter more for long-term brain health than one isolated beverage choice.
Portion awareness still matters. A 12-fluid-ounce can provides a defined serving, while large fountain drinks can encourage more frequent intake.

How much is reasonable?
No universal brain-specific limit exists for diet soda. Frequency, serving size, caffeine intake, medical conditions, and dietary pattern all matter.
An occasional can presents a different exposure than several large servings every day. Habitual high intake deserves a closer look, even without symptoms.
Try a simple test. Record servings, caffeine, sleep, headaches, and cravings for one week. Then reduce intake for another week and compare the results.
This approach is not perfect. Personal tracking cannot diagnose disease, but it can reveal a useful pattern.
When to ask a clinician
Seek medical advice for new memory problems, confusion, repeated severe headaches, weakness, speech changes, or vision loss. Do not blame these symptoms on diet soda alone.
Ask a clinician about caffeine if you have palpitations, uncontrolled blood pressure, panic symptoms, or persistent insomnia. Discuss sweetener exposure if you have phenylketonuria and the product contains aspartame.

What the evidence means for you
The strongest current position is cautious, not alarmist. Diet soda can reduce sugar compared with regular soda, yet frequent intake may fit poorly with sleep, appetite, or personal symptoms.
Advice changed because researchers moved from ingredient fears to long-term population studies. Those studies raised useful questions, but they did not prove direct brain damage.
Choose water most often when you can. Treat diet soda as an optional beverage, track caffeine, and judge the habit within your complete diet and health profile.
Frequently asked questions
Does diet soda damage brain cells?
There is no strong human evidence showing ordinary diet soda intake directly kills brain cells. Existing studies mainly report associations with longer-term outcomes.
Can diet soda cause memory loss?
It has not been proven to cause memory loss. New or worsening memory problems need medical assessment, regardless of beverage intake.
Is caffeine the main brain risk?
Caffeine is the clearest short-term brain-related factor. It can improve alertness, but it can also disturb sleep, cause jitters, or trigger headaches.
Does zero sugar mean zero health effect?
No. Zero sugar describes one nutrition feature. Caffeine, acidity, carbonation, sweeteners, drinking frequency, and replacement choices still matter.
Can diet soda help me lose weight?
It may help when it replaces sugary drinks and does not increase later snacking. Weight results vary because people respond differently to sweet taste and appetite cues.
Should children drink diet soda?
Children generally need little caffeine. Water and milk usually fit better as regular choices. Check pediatric guidance for a child with specific medical needs.
Is one can a day dangerous?
Research does not show a clear brain danger from one ordinary serving. Your total caffeine intake and personal response still matter.
Which diet soda is safest?
No single brand suits everyone. Check caffeine, sweeteners, serving size, and your own symptoms. A product with no caffeine may suit someone whose sleep suffers.
